What Is Negligent Hiring in the Trucking Industry?
Trucking companies have a legal duty to exercise reasonable care when hiring drivers. This means they are expected to take certain steps before putting someone on the road, including:
- Conducting background checks
- Verifying driving records
- Confirming proper licensing
- Screening for substance abuse issues
When a company skips out on these steps and hires a driver who goes on to cause an accident, the company itself can be held directly liable.
Common Signs of Negligent Hiring
Some of the red flags that may point to negligent hiring include:
- Hiring a driver with a history of DUI or other serious traffic violations
- Failing to verify that the driver holds a valid commercial driver’s license (CDL)
- Skipping required drug and alcohol testing
- Hiring a driver who has been terminated from a previous carrier for safety violations
Federal regulations enforced by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) set specific standards for what trucking companies must do before hiring a driver. We will work hard to determine if any of them were violated in your case.
How Much Is My Miami Negligent Hiring Truck Accident Case Worth?
Every truck accident case is different at the end of the day, so there’s no uniform answer to this question. That said, negligent hiring claims against trucking companies do tend to carry higher value than standard car accident cases because of the severity of the injuries involved and the additional liability on the part of the carrier.
Some of the factors that can influence what your case is ultimately worth include:
- The severity of your injuries and whether you’ll make a full recovery
- The total amount of your medical bills and other financial losses
- The nature and extent of your pain and suffering
- Whether the trucking company’s conduct was reckless enough to justify punitive damages
- The amount of available insurance coverage
- The strength of the evidence connecting the company’s hiring practices to your accident
